Tamron 24-70mm G2 canon EF- with Canon R

Hello I use over a year now canon R with Tamron 24-70 g2 and I have an issue even I take my lens in service, and they confirmed that i have last firmware also. I have the issue that when I use them for sometime and my camera goes to stand by mode my focus on my Tamron Locks and I have to tune off my camera or remove my lens to work again. Its very annoying and I can't find any solutions because I don't fined someone else speaks about it.

I don't have a Canon camera and others on here may know more than I do about the difficulties you are having, but it sounds to me as though your camera is turning off to save power - most cameras have this facility, batteries can be very quickly depleted and then nothing will work. The lens will also turn off. I have always been in the habit of turning my cameras off when I am not actually in the process of photographing, this saves battery and 'reboots' both camera and lens, have you tried this to see if it solves your problem?
